A BILL
FOR
An Act to amend certain Acts relating to transportation Transport Legislation Amendment (No. 2)
The Parliament of Queensland enacts—
PART 1—PRELIMINARY
Short title
Clause1. This Act may be cited as the Transport Legislation Amendment Act (No. 2) 1993.
Commencement
Clause2. This Act commences on a day to be fixed by proclamation.
PART 2—AMENDMENT OF TRAFFIC ACT AND ANOTHER ACT AMENDMENT ACT 1990
Amended Act
Clause3. The Traffic Act and Another Act Amendment Act 1990 is amended as set out in this Act.
Amendment of s.2.25 (Amendment of Schedule) Clause4, Section 2.25(c)—
omit.
Omission of Part 3 (Amendment of State Transport Act 1960) Clause5. Part 3—
omit. 12 1417Transport Legislation Amendment (No. 2)
PART 3—AMENDMENT OF STATE TRANSPORT ACT 1960
Amended Act Clause6. The State Transport Act 1960 is amended as set out in this Part.
Omission of s.62 (Limits of continuous driving hours) Clause7. Section 62—
omit.
Amendment of Schedule (Subject matters for regulations) Clause8.(1) Clause 12—
omit, insert— 'Motor vehicle driving hours and rest periods
12.(1) Providing for the control of drivers of motor vehicles in relation to matters necessary to ensure that drivers are in a fit state of health and wellbeing to drive motor vehicles safely, including, for example, requirements for resting.
